Blaise Museum

About

Blaise Museum is set within the grand Blaise Castle House, an 18th‑century mansion surrounded by 650 acres of landscaped parkland in Henbury, Bristol. Once the home of the Harford family, the house became a museum in 1949 and today showcases the city’s rich social history collections. Inside, visitors can explore rooms filled with everyday objects from centuries past, including toys, costumes, kitchenware, and domestic tools that reveal how people lived, worked, and played. The highlight is the magnificent Picture Room, hung with paintings from the museum’s collection and admired for its elegant Georgian design. Beyond the house, the estate offers sweeping parkland, woodlands, and the romantic folly of Blaise Castle, making it a favourite spot for walks and family outings. With free entry, seasonal events, and a setting that combines history, art, and nature, Blaise Museum provides both a cultural experience and a chance to enjoy one of Bristol’s most beautiful historic landscapes.

Location

Blaise Museum is located on Henbury Road, Bristol, BS10 7QS, set within the expansive Blaise Castle Estate, covering 650 acres of parkland, woodlands, and gardens. The museum is housed in an 18th-century mansion that offers a rich insight into Bristol’s social history with collections of domestic objects, toys, and costumes from the past three centuries. Nearby within the estate are the Blaise Castle folly, visitor café, children’s adventure playground, and walking trails with scenic views. The estate is well connected by bus routes, and the surrounding natural setting makes it a popular spot for both cultural visits and outdoor activities including picnics, nature walks, and family outings.
